I wasn’t going to do this but after reading several posts throughout my Facebook feed, I had to. So many do not understand the toll severe depression or any mental illness, takes on a body. Not only for the individual, but for the people around them. Unless you’ve experienced it, don’t judge…you really have no idea.

Major depression is one of the most common mental disorders in the United States. In 2012, an estimated 16 million adults aged 18 or older in the U.S. had at least one major depressive episode in the past year. This represented 6.9 percent of all U.S. adults. (info via http://www.nimh.nih.gov/ )
